The pharmacological profile of a new, safe, and effective hydrogen sulfide h 2 sreleasing derivative of aspirin acs14 is described. We report the synthesis of acs14, and of its deacetylated metabolite acs21, the preliminary pharmacokinetics, and its in vivo metabolism, with the h 2 s plasma levels after intravenous administration in the rat.
